Dentofacial orthopedics focuses on guiding the development of the face and jaws, how the bones and cells of the face work with each other, and how they affect feature and look. AAO orthodontists' expertise in dentofacial orthopedics allows them to properly remedy malocclusions and monitor jaw development in its early stages. What is the difference in between a dentist and an orthodontist? To address a concern that is usually asked, both dentists and orthodontists aid patients obtain far better oral health and wellness, albeit in different means. It aids to bear in mind that dentistry is an instead wide science with various medical field of expertises. All dentists, including orthodontists, treat the teeth, periodontals, jaw and nerves.
You can assume of both physicians that treat gum and teeth troubles. The main difference is that ending up being an orthodontist needs a particular specialized in treating the imbalance of the teeth and jaw.

Orthodontists deal with a certain set of oral problems, meaning they deal with imbalances in the teeth and other associated abnormalities. Several of the conditions that they deal with consist of the following: Jaw imbalance Teeth that are also far apart Congested teeth Overbites Underbites Crooked teeth As you can see, these are details types of dental conditions aside from the usual problems general dentists take care of
